Notes: "In the village of San Miguel de Horcasitas on the twelfth of the month of December of 1763, I, the Bachiller Don Miguel Joseph de Arenibar, designated priest, benefactor for His Majesty, vicar and ecclesiastic judge of this Province of Sonora, provided ecclesiastical burial for the body of Santiago, Spaniard an infant son of Doming Albizu and Ángela Trejo, with the lower cross beneath the choir loft, and for this truth I signed == Miguel Josef de Arenibar
